Ongoing, First published Apr 30, 2012
Reagan Spencer's lived a hard life. She's been abused since the young age of 3 and as a way to cope she turned to fighting. But what happens when her only way to cope turns into the one thing that ruins her? Is there something or someone who can save Reagan from herself?
